Factors Affecting Cost

Foundation jacking is a process used to lift and stabilize structures that have settled or shifted over time. In Church Hill, TN, homeowners and property owners may consider this method to address uneven foundations caused by soil movement or other factors.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for foundation jacking services.

  • Materials: Common materials include steel piers, concrete, or helical piles, chosen based on soil conditions and structure requirements.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ential adjustments to large commercial structures, depending on the extent of settlement.
  • Labor Complexity: The process involves precise lifting and stabilization, often requiring specialized equipment and skilled labor.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Church Hill may necessitate permits for foundation work, especially for larger or structural modifications.
  • Additional Options: Some projects include underpinning, crack repair, or moisture barrier installation as part of the overall foundation stabilization plan.
